# Expansion: Norvale Region

**Restricted: Managers**

Go-live for the Norvale territory is set for early next year. Two sales pods transfer from Ashgrave; local hires follow in phase two. Quotas stay provisional until the first full quarter. Distribution runs through the Pellmont warehouse initially.

Sales leads: do not discuss timing with partners yet. Legal review of the reseller terms is pending.

The rationale behind the timing is noted below.

confidential, kagup-bafog: Fraaxax Group is in early talks to buy Soroxox Group for about $343.8 million. The Olidor launch date is June 14, and nothing goes to the press before then. Legal wants the Aldmirek Logistics term sheet signed before July 23.

CI NOTE — Hot-reload flake in config watcher tests

Reviewer: the Merridew config watcher occasionally misses the second reload event because the temp-file rename lands within the same mtime granularity. The fix polls on content hash rather than mtime, with a 50ms debounce. Please check the new test asserts both reloads observed. The run that reproduced the flake is identified below.

pipeline stamp: htk9_b3279b371

## Deploying the Gatewick Proctor Queue

Deploys are pretty painless: push to main, wait for the pipeline, then watch the queue drain dashboard for five minutes. If candidates pile up mid-exam, roll back first and ask questions later — the queue replays safely. Everything the workers care about lives in one config block, shown here for reference.

settings of bafof-yagef:
JOROX_PIN=8740
JOROX_TENANT=pelox
JOROX_METRICS_HOST=metrics.jorox.qorvelworks.internal
JOROX_SEAL=seal_c78f63c1
JOROX_STANDBY_TEAM=norax

Changed defaults in Splitfork, our assignment service. Bucketing now uses sticky hashing per account instead of per session, and the holdout slice grew from 2% to 5%. Callers relying on session-level reassignment must opt in explicitly. Review the diff against the new baseline; the updated default configuration is listed below.

config for tagep-kajof:
[casir]
port = 6379
region = south-1
host = casir.paliqdyn.example
team = tamax
timeout_ms = 250
retries = 2